The Key Takeaway: HWMonitor RTX 50 Hotspot Readings Finally Make Sense

HWMonitor v1.65.1 is a lightweight hardware monitoring update that stabilizes GPU hotspot temperature readings on NVIDIA RTX 50 series cards, removing a confusing second hotspot and aligning its RTX 50 monitoring data with what enthusiasts already trust from other tools. That might sound minor, but it addresses a real problem: version 1.65 introduced hotspot support on RTX 50x0 GPUs, then delivered fluctuating, overly high values and two separate hotspot sensors that left users guessing which number to believe. The new build cuts the noise, keeps a single meaningful GPU hotspot temperature, and puts HWMonitor back in the category of reliable, everyday tools for people who care about thermal behavior under load. What Changed: From Dual Hotspots to a Single Reliable GPU Hotspot Temperature

The story starts with HWMonitor 1.65, which added hotspot temperature support for NVIDIA RTX 50x0 GPUs after leaving it out of earlier versions. Instead of one reading, though, users saw two hotspots for RTX 50 monitoring, with reports suggesting one belonged to the GPU chip and the other to the VRM. On paper, that sounds helpful; in practice, it turned into guesswork. According to coverage of the update, CPUID has now removed the second hotspot from the interface and kept the primary hotspot for monitoring the GPU temperature. That single decision matters more than it appears. Hotspot, by definition, is the hottest point on the GPU die, the figure most enthusiasts treat as the thermal ceiling. Splitting attention between two competing “max” readings undermines the purpose. Version 1.65.1 restores clarity: one hotspot, one top temperature to watch.

The Temperature Fluctuations Fix: Why Stability Beats Alarmism

The dual-hotspot experiment would have been tolerable if the readings were trustworthy. They were not. Users reported that HWMonitor 1.65 showed a lot of fluctuation in GPU hotspot readings and much higher temperatures than expected, casting doubt on whether the sensor mapping was correct. Those exaggerated swings risk nudging cautious users into overreacting—dialing back clocks, redoing thermal paste, or blaming a card that might be fine. CPUID responded quickly: another HWMonitor update, v1.65.1, was pushed to fix these issues and is now available from the official site. According to @unikoshardware, the new version not only reduces the hotspot temperature to match other utilities but also cuts those fluctuations significantly, making the readings much more stable than before. Reliable monitoring doesn’t mean showing the highest number possible; it means showing the right number, consistently enough that you can base decisions on it.

Alignment With HWinfo and AIDA64: Trust Through Consistency

HWMonitor has always positioned itself as a clear, reliable way to read system health sensors, covering voltages, temperatures, fan speeds, and power use across CPUs, GPUs, and other components. But reliability in monitoring is now a multi-tool game. Enthusiasts often cross-check GPU hotspot temperature against HWinfo or AIDA64 before making changes to cooling or power limits. That’s why the v1.65.1 change is bigger than a bug fix: tests cited in recent coverage confirm that hotspot readings now match what those other popular utilities show and no longer spike randomly. In practical terms, this means HWMonitor RTX 50 users can keep one window open during stress tests and trust that its hotspot data is in line with their wider monitoring stack.
